
01 May Filled to Overflowing
There was once a time when I was miserable in our fertility journey. I was trying to control the outcome. I was doing whatever I could to make a baby happen. I was desperate. I was bitter and jealous. I didn’t have hope or joy.
The main reason I was so miserable? I hadn’t surrendered our story over to God. Instead of focusing on Him, all I cared about was a baby.
Thankfully in August 2013, after hitting rock-bottom, I had a turning point. Everything changed the moment I chose to put my hope and trust in God. Instead of walking in bitterness, unbelief, fear and doubt, my cup was filled to overflowing.
In preparation of launching A Cup Full of Hope Podcast I have been meditating on Romans 15:13, which is the main verse for our podcast. It says, “Now may God, the inspiration and fountain of hope, fill you to overflowing with uncontainable joy and perfect peace as you trust in him. And may the power of the Holy Spirit continually surround your life with his super-abundance until you radiate with hope!”
I can relate so much to this verse and I speak for both Jessica, my co-host, and I when I say, this is the core of who we are. Our cups are filled to overflowing. It’s certainly not because life is smooth-sailing. It’s definitely not because we have received everything we have asked for or desired. But it’s because just as this verse says, we have put our trust in him.
I think it can be so easy to love verses like Romans 15:13, but overlook the key conditional causes such as “trust in him.” A few weeks ago I shared on the topic of reaping the promises in scripture. If you want to reap the harvest, which in this verse is joy and peace, then you have to plant the seeds, which is putting your trust in God. You reap what you sow and if you don’t sow trust, then you won’t reap the benefits of Romans 15:13.
Our hope for the podcast is that you too would understand you can be filled to overflowing, even in the middle of the worst situations or circumstances. In fact, the God of hope wants to fill you with joy and peace today but in order to receive the promise you are going to have to put your trust in him.
So, do you trust God? Do you actually trust Him with your whole heart and mind? It is time to surrender! It is time to put your trust in Him! And when you do? You will experience uncontainable joy, perfect peace and you too will radiate with hope!
